The Core of​ John Daly’s ⁤#1 Golf Swing Tip: Relax Your ‌grip‌ and Swing Free

While many golfers ‌obsess​ over stance, alignment, and club selection, John Daly⁢ emphasizes one ​basic aspect that’s often overlooked ‌– the grip pressure. Daly’s #1 secret to a better golf ⁣swing is maintaining a relaxed grip to⁢ encourage a smoother, more natural swing.

Why is grip pressure⁣ so crucial? ‍ A tense grip leads to tension in your arms, shoulders, and upper body. This tension limits clubhead speed, disrupts ⁤timing, and causes inconsistent⁣ ball striking. Daly ​has often said that swinging “too tight” is the biggest​ mistake amateurs make,leading‌ to slices,hooks,or ⁣fat shots.

How to Apply the Relaxed Grip Tip Effectively

  • Grip Lightly But Securely: Hold the club like ​you’re holding a small⁢ bird—firm enough to not drop it,​ but gentle enough not to squeeze.
  • Check Your Hands During Practice: Pay attention‍ to your fingertips;‍ a​ proper grip rests ⁤more in the fingers than the palm.
  • Perform Tension Tests: Before each swing, tighten your grip intentionally, then immediately release to relax. ‍This contrast helps you feel the ideal pressure.
  • Focus on Smooth Rhythm: A relaxed grip promotes a smoother swing, encouraging better tempo and⁢ natural rotation throughout the takeaway and ‍follow-through.

Step-by-Step Practical Tips to Integrate ⁤Daly’s​ Tip Into Your Routine

Here is a simple‌ routine golfers can incorporate during every practice session or round to harness john Daly’s swing advancement advice:

Step Action Why It Works
1 Grip the ⁤club lightly, focusing on fingertips. Encourages a natural wrist ​hinge and fluid motion.
2 Perform slow mirror ​swings focusing on relaxed grip. Builds⁤ muscle memory⁤ without tension.
3 Before each swing, squeeze your grip then release. Becomes aware⁣ of tension; ‌learn to avoid it instinctively.
4 practice with different clubs focusing ⁤on grip pressure. Improves adaptability⁣ across the bag ​and shot types.
5 Use breath control ‌– exhale gently on your downswing. Further relaxes muscles during critical swing phase.

additional Tips to⁤ Complement Daly’s Golf Swing Advice

For the best results, incorporate these complementary practices:

  • Warm Up ⁣Properly: Loosen your wrists and forearms pre-round to encourage a relaxed grip.
  • Video Your Swing: Analyze to spot any gripping tension ⁢during the‌ backswing or follow-through.
  • Stay Mentally Calm: Anxiety tightens muscles—practice breathing and visualization ⁣techniques.
